BP to pay $4 billion for Gulf spill, plead guilty to 12 felony counts
Posted on November 15, 2012 at 6:21 AM
Updated Thursday, Nov 15 at 5:34 PM
BP has announced that it will pay $4 billion in criminal penalties and plead guilty to 12 felony counts and two misdemeanors for its negligence and role in the Deepwater Horizon rig explosion and oil spill in 2010.
